Protests in Afghanistan: Our excuse to get out

posted by
April 4, 2011
The Huffington Post
by Malou Innocent  
Posted in Commentary, PND Commentary

"General David Petraeus, the head of American forces in Afghanistan, has emphasized the importance of winning the 'hearts and minds' of Afghans by treating them and their culture with respect. Pentagon officials may want to reexamine that assumption, but not for the reason you might think." (04/04/11)  

Tags: ,

Our Sponsors